    Prof. Ye Qizheng, PhD. was born in Wuhan, China in 1965. He received the B.S. degree in physics in 1986, the M.S. degree in optical instruments in 1991, and the Ph.D. degree in electrical engineering in 2001. His main research interests include electrical insulation and gas discharge, discharge plasma and its application, electromagnetic phenomena in complex fluids.
